From 6b8b3f854206bd0db0d54f9b9fa26dffeb7c63cd Mon Sep 17 00:00:00 2001 From: meenu-deriv Date: Mon, 15 Apr 2024 16:00:22 +0400 Subject: [PATCH] fix: updated captiontext for numbers --- lib/components/Pagination/base/index.tsx | 8 +++++++- lib/components/Pagination/base/pagination-base.scss | 12 ++++++++---- lib/components/Typography/caption/index.tsx | 2 +- 3 files changed, 16 insertions(+), 6 deletions(-) diff --git a/lib/components/Pagination/base/index.tsx b/lib/components/Pagination/base/index.tsx index 98c071e3..e55789c7 100644 --- a/lib/components/Pagination/base/index.tsx +++ b/lib/components/Pagination/base/index.tsx @@ -5,6 +5,7 @@ import { import { DOTS } from "../../../hooks/usePaginationRange.tsx"; import { PaginationProps } from "../types"; import "./pagination-base.scss"; +import { CaptionText } from "../../Typography/caption"; interface PaginationButtonProps extends Pick { pageNumber: number | string; @@ -58,7 +59,12 @@ const PaginationButton = ({ onClick={(e) => handleOnClick(e.currentTarget.textContent)} className="variant__number" > - {pageNumber} + + {pageNumber} + ); }; diff --git a/lib/components/Pagination/base/pagination-base.scss b/lib/components/Pagination/base/pagination-base.scss index 2d11f2c5..4e9c05b6 100644 --- a/lib/components/Pagination/base/pagination-base.scss +++ b/lib/components/Pagination/base/pagination-base.scss @@ -26,10 +26,7 @@ background-color: var(--core-color-solid-slate-1400); } } - color: var(--semantic-color-typography-default); - &[aria-current=true] { - color: var(--core-color-solid-slate-50); - } + } &__bullet { @@ -45,4 +42,11 @@ } .hidden_pages { display: flex; +} +.number-text{ + &[aria-current=true]{ + font-weight: bold; + color: var(--core-color-solid-slate-50); + } + color: var(--semantic-color-typography-default); } \ No newline at end of file diff --git a/lib/components/Typography/caption/index.tsx b/lib/components/Typography/caption/index.tsx index 15c1868e..5a6dec9b 100644 --- a/lib/components/Typography/caption/index.tsx +++ b/lib/components/Typography/caption/index.tsx @@ -13,7 +13,7 @@ export const CaptionText = ({ as = "p", italic = false, underlined = false, - bold = true, + bold = false, ...rest }: TypographyProps) => { const decoration = getTextDecoration(italic, underlined);